- Chef Sergio Bastard's restaurant in Santander tops the TOP100 2020, the list of restaurants that have succeeded the most in 2020 and that each year ElTenedor elaborates based on the opinions of the thousands of users who reserve and eat every day with the app
- The Community of Madrid with 18 restaurants within the ranking is the region with the most representation in Spain. Meanwhile, Catalonia manages to add up to 15 restaurants, while the Valencian Community registers a total of 11
- The TOP100 of ElTenedor restaurants 2020 is presented by American Express, as a sign of their commitment and support to the restaurant industry

To make this list, TheFork has taken into account different criteria such as the grades obtained by the restaurants during this 2020, the volume of views during this year, visits to the restaurant file and reservations generated. In this way, the TOP100 restaurants are also part of the selection INSIDER ElTenedor, where the best restaurants of the moment stand out, those who have stood out for something special, including also those awarded by the MICHELIN Guide in Spain.
This year has been The Jewish House the one that heads the list of the TOP100 of ElTenedor, presented by American Express. A restaurant located in an old 19th century Indian house in Santander and run by the Catalan chef Sergio Bastard. Your kitchen, recognized by the MICHELIN Guide with the distinction "MICHELIN Plate: a quality kitchen ", mix originality and tradition in equal parts, with an established technique and using local Cantabrian products as protagonists of all its elaborations. A set of ingredients that have placed it as the favorite of the Spanish of the 2020.

Practically the entire Spanish geography is represented in this ranking, although with special protagonism of the Community of Madrid that has managed to include 18 of its restaurants on this list, 13 of them located in the interior of Madrid capital. Among the restaurants that top the list of this region are Horcher (12) Y Madrid home by Martin Berasategui (22).
Nevertheless, It is the Cantabrian community that has two of the favorite restaurants of the year: Jewish house (1) Y Gazebo Amos by Jesús Sánchez (2), that repeats position also this year. This podium is completed by the well-known restaurant The Portal of the Echaurren by Francís Paniego (3) in La Rioja, also present in last year's TOP100.
Other restaurants that remain in the Top10 of the 2020 son El Bohio (4), led by Pepe Rodríguez, winner of the last edition of the Top100 of ElTenedor, Y Martin Berasategui (6), which topped the list in 2018. On the other hand, It remains in this list restaurants such as Estate (10), recently awarded its first MICHELIN star and managed by chef Carlos Maldonado.
